  • Which sections of Melbourne are best for finding holiday parks?

    Most holiday parks in Melbourne are located on the outskirts of the city, like in the suburbs of Frankston, Mornington Peninsula, or along the Bellarine Peninsula. You'll find some closer to the city centre too, in places like St Kilda or Williamstown.

  • What should travelers know about the weather, wildlife, or natural hazards in Melbourne?

    Melbourne has a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. In summer, it can get quite hot, so be sure to stay hydrated. You might see some native wildlife like kangaroos, koalas, and wombats in the bush, but they are generally harmless. Be aware of bushfires in summer, especially in the drier months.
